t9402-git-cvsserver-refs: don't check the stderr of a subshellsg/cvs-tests-with-x
Four 'cvs diff' related tests in 't9402-git-cvsserver-refs.sh' fail when the test script is run with '-x' tracing (and using a shell other than a Bash version supporting BASH_XTRACEFD). The reason for those failures is that the tests check the emptiness of a subshell's stderr, which includes the trace of commands executed in that subshell as well, throwing off the emptiness check. Save the stdout and stderr of the invoked 'cvs' command instead of the whole subshell, so the latter remains free from tracing output. (Note that changing how stdout is saved is only done for the sake of consistency, it's not necessary for correctness.) After this change t9402 passes with '-x', even when running with /bin/sh.
